Assassin's Creed: Nexus is the working title for an upcoming installment in the Assassin's Creed series. It is being developed by Ubisoft's Red Storm Entertainment and will release for the Oculus Quest.

Development

Initially announced alongside the since-canceled Tom Clancy's Splinter Cell VR at the Oculus Quest virtual event in September 2020, Nexus is being developed primarily by Red Storm Entertainment with additional help from Ubisoft Düsseldorf, Ubisoft Mumbai, and Ubisoft Reflections.[1][2]

The conceptual title of the game, Assassin's Creed: Nexus, was credibly leaked on 6 September 2022 and reported by Tom Henderson of Try Hard Guides.[3] Henderson has also reportedly leaked many more details of the game, none of which have been substantiated.[1]
